Resurrecting the Champ

Resurrecting the Champ

Year: 2007

Runtime: 112 min

Language: english

Director: Rod Lurie

DramaSport

A sports reporter discovers a homeless man who bears a striking resemblance to a legendary, previously presumed deceased, heavyweight boxer. As the journalist investigates, he uncovers the truth behind "The Champ's" disappearance and the tragic circumstances that led to his downfall. The story explores themes of resilience, redemption, and the enduring power of the human spirit, following the boxer's journey through hardship and a surprising opportunity for a comeback.

In the bustling newsroom of a Denver newspaper, Erik Kernan Jr. wrestles with the weight of a celebrated father’s legacy while trying to carve out his own voice as a sports reporter. His days are colored by the subtle pressure of an editor who demands excitement, and by a small, honest desire to appear larger-than-life to his curious son. The city’s streets pulse with the ordinary dramas of everyday life, providing a realistic backdrop where ambition and personal history constantly collide.

One crisp evening, after covering a routine sporting event, Erik’s routine is shattered by a startling sight in a dim parking lot: a homeless man who calls himself “Champ” and claims a storied past in the boxing ring. Champ’s gritty charisma and unpolished skill hint at a life once lived under bright lights, stirring Erik’s journalistic instincts and offering a tantalizing glimpse of a story that could bridge his professional frustrations with his yearning for significance.

Seeing an unexpected chance for redemption, Erik enlists the help of a diligent research assistant, Polly, whose quiet tenacity balances his restless drive. Together they begin to peel back layers of memory and rumor, tracing the faded outlines of a once‑legendary heavyweight’s career. The investigation becomes more than a professional scoop; it morphs into a quiet meditation on the price of fame, the allure of second chances, and the quiet dignity found in the margins of society.

The film settles into a contemplative, character‑driven tone that blends the gritty realism of a city’s underbelly with the hopeful cadence of an underdog narrative. As Erik navigates the blurry line between myth and truth, the story invites viewers to wonder how far one will go to resurrect not just a career, but a sense of purpose, and whether the true champion emerges from the ring or from within.
